Recognizing the Duty of a Registered Agent in Corporations


A corporation registered agent acts as the main factor of call between the company and state authorities, guaranteeing that lawful files, consisting of claims, subpoenas, and official notices, are dependably gotten and sent to the appropriate individuals within the company. This function is critical for keeping conformity with state guidelines, as failure to have a marked registered agent or to maintain their information current can lead to charges, default judgments, and even the involuntary dissolution of the corporation. The registered agent has to have a physical address within the state of unification and be offered throughout normal company hours to accept service of procedure. Several corporations select a private within the business or an exterior professional service specializing in registered agent duties to meet this duty. The significance of a trusted registered agent expands beyond lawful conformity; it additionally makes certain that the company continues to be notified of any lawsuits or government interactions, which is vital for timely feedbacks and keeping good standing. Choosing the ideal registered agent can also impact personal privacy, as using a third-party solution can help maintain the business's physical address off public documents. Generally, a registered agent serves as an important web link in the administrative and legal framework of a company, protecting its lawful passions and ensuring smooth communication with authorities and stakeholders alike.
